Output c8d31b9cf92f6181fd41ff6061293627e79776c90d814cbaf13b0a6ef4740f89:2

value
637560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9a0ef708632d232f28d7e6780aa990348ade14e OP_EQUAL
address
3QSvyHq1kqcezH49eWFSkqQpaCYoWzSMKB
transaction
c8d31b9cf92f6181fd41ff6061293627e79776c90d814cbaf13b0a6ef4740f89